Myanmar Daily Weather Report
(Issued at 7:00 am on Sunday 9th August, 2015)
BAY INFERENCE: Monsoon is weak in the North Bay and strong to vigorous in the Andaman Sea and elsewhere in the Bay of Bengal.
FORECAST VALID UNTIL EVENING OF THE 9th August, 2015: Rain or thundershowers will be scattered in Magway Region and Kayah State, fairly widespread in Lower Sagaing, Mandalay, Bago, Yangon and Ayeyarwady Regions, Shan and Rakhine States and widespread in the remaining Regions and States with likelihood of isolated heavy falls in Mandalay, Ayeyarwady and Taninthayi Regions, Chin and Mon States. Degree of certainty is (100%).
STATE OF THE SEA: Squalls with moderate to rough sea are likely at times Deltaic, Gulf of Mottama, off and along Mon - Taninthayi Coasts. Surface wind speed in squalls may reach (35) m.p.h. Sea will be moderate elsewhere in Myanmar waters.
OUTLOOK FOR SUBSEQUENT TWO DAYS: Likelihood of increase of rain in the Upper Myanmar areas.
FORECAST FOR NAYPYITAW AND NEIGHBOURING AREA FOR 9th August, 2015: Isolated rain or thundershowers. Degree of certainty is (80%).
FORECAST FOR YANGON AND NEIGHBOURING AREA FOR 9th August, 2015: One or two rain or thundershowers. Degree of certainty is (100%).
FORECAST FOR MANDALAY AND NEIGHBOURING AREA FOR 9th August, 2015: One or two rain or thundershowers. Degree of certainty is (100%).
